Giggle, laugh and mock all you want but I think that the Titans DEF are viable starters for the upcoming weeks. They were not fantasy studs against Indy but then again, which DEF is?

The matchup against the Aint's shows promise for TEN to be a great emerging sleeper pick. Look at their matchups;

Week 5 - Atlanta (need I say more?)

Week 6 - Tampa Bay (low scoring affair)

Week 7 - Houston (no Johnson, no offense)

Week 8 - Oakland (Yep, we're all afraid of McCown & D-Cup!)

Week 9 - Carolina (whether it's Carr or Delhomme, bring some popcorn)

Wee 10 - Jacksonville (who's going to be betting on this inept offense?)

For the next 6 weeks, you have a solution at DEF if you're stuck with underachievers
